Re: ceph mds dump tree - root inode is not in cache

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Hi Frank,

I have not experienced this before. Maybe mds.tceph-03 is in standby state? Could you show the output of “ceph fs status”?

You can also try “ceph tell mds.0 …” and let ceph find the correct daemon for you.

You may also try dumping “~mds0/stray0”.

Weiwen Hu

> 在 2022年8月4日,23:22,Frank Schilder <frans@xxxxxx> 写道:
> 
> Hi all,
> 
> I'm stuck with a very annoying problem with a ceph octopus test cluster (latest stable version). I need to investigate the contents of the MDS stray buckets and something like this should work:
> 
> [root@ceph-adm:tceph-03 ~]# ceph daemon mds.tceph-03 dump tree '~mdsdir' 3
> [root@ceph-adm:tceph-03 ~]# ceph tell mds.tceph-03 dump tree '~mdsdir/stray0'
> 2022-08-04T16:57:54.010+0200 7f3475ffb700  0 client.371437 ms_handle_reset on v2:10.41.24.15:6812/2903519715
> 2022-08-04T16:57:54.052+0200 7f3476ffd700  0 client.371443 ms_handle_reset on v2:10.41.24.15:6812/2903519715
> root inode is not in cache
> 
> However, I either get nothing or an error message. Whatever I try, I cannot figure out how to pull the root inode into the MDS cache - if this is even the problem here. I also don't understand why the annoying ms_handle_reset messages are there. I found the second command in a script:
> 
> Code line: https://nam12.safelinks.protection.outlook.com/?url=https%3A%2F%2Fgist.github.com%2Fhuww98%2F91cbff0782ad4f6673dcffccce731c05%23file-cephfs-reintegrate-conda-stray-py-L11&amp;data=05%7C01%7C%7C8c073b7e1d98481f873908da762d2110%7C84df9e7fe9f640afb435aaaaaaaaaaaa%7C1%7C0%7C637952233466034022%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C3000%7C%7C%7C&amp;sdata=zS7Z2%2B1nYrhl39T8nvTRr33AgVmhlray4Gi8RH7C7UU%3D&amp;reserved=0
> 
> that came up in this conversation: https://nam12.safelinks.protection.outlook.com/?url=https%3A%2F%2Flists.ceph.io%2Fhyperkitty%2Flist%2Fceph-users%40ceph.io%2Fmessage%2F4TDASTSWF4UIURKUN2P7PGZZ3V5SCCEE%2F&amp;data=05%7C01%7C%7C8c073b7e1d98481f873908da762d2110%7C84df9e7fe9f640afb435aaaaaaaaaaaa%7C1%7C0%7C637952233466034022%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C3000%7C%7C%7C&amp;sdata=Es%2FCebNVrmDP1afP7gZYYxfly%2BNkMYtElOae83WKzFc%3D&amp;reserved=0
> 
> The only place I can find "root inode is not in cache" is https://nam12.safelinks.protection.outlook.com/?url=https%3A%2F%2Ftracker.ceph.com%2Fissues%2F53597%23note-14&amp;data=05%7C01%7C%7C8c073b7e1d98481f873908da762d2110%7C84df9e7fe9f640afb435aaaaaaaaaaaa%7C1%7C0%7C637952233466190258%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C3000%7C%7C%7C&amp;sdata=ZPncxAhS4abFsrPbTTrnB6P3kZTC5TnzepeAkONqcVw%3D&amp;reserved=0, where it says that the above commands should return the tree. I have ca. 1mio stray entries and they must be somewhere. mds.tceph-03 is the only active MDS.
> 
> Can someone help me out here?
> 
> Thanks and best regards,
> =================
> Frank Schilder
> AIT Risø Campus
> Bygning 109, rum S14
> _______________________________________________
> ceph-users mailing list -- ceph-users@xxxxxxx
> To unsubscribe send an email to ceph-users-leave@xxxxxxx
_______________________________________________
ceph-users mailing list -- ceph-users@xxxxxxx
To unsubscribe send an email to ceph-users-leave@xxxxxxx




[Index of Archives]     [Information on CEPH]     [Linux Filesystem Development]     [Ceph Development]     [Ceph Large]     [Ceph Dev]     [Linux USB Development]     [Video for Linux]     [Linux Audio Users]     [Yosemite News]     [Linux Kernel]     [Linux SCSI]     [xfs]


  Powered by Linux